Govern AI Marketing Quality covers the growing need for a lightweight review layer that sits between AI-assisted content creation and public launch, helping small teams catch brand, factual, strategic, and conversion risks before they ship. It is getting attention now because marketing teams are using generative tools to produce copy, visuals, presentations, videos, and campaign variants at a speed that outpaces human review, while the cost of a bad launch has gone up: one off-brand ad can weaken trust, one unsupported claim can create legal exposure, and one generic campaign can waste budget on assets that look polished but do not convert.

The pain points are practical and immediate. Teams struggle with AI output that drifts from brand voice, introduces inconsistent terminology, or produces generic phrasing that senior marketers must rewrite by hand.

They also deal with visual problems such as warped text, broken layouts, and inconsistent design when generating batches of ads or social assets. Another common issue is compliance and disclosure, where marketers need the correct disclaimer or claim language for a specific product or channel but cannot keep up with changing legal requirements.

On top of that, AI-generated facts, quotes, and product statements can be wrong, making it hard to trust drafts without a slow manual fact-check. A fifth pain point is strategic: founders and non-specialist marketers often push AI-generated campaign ideas that sound plausible but lack budget realism, timeline clarity, or execution feasibility, leaving teams to reject them without a structured rationale.

The typical audience includes SMB owners, in-house marketing teams, agency operators, solo marketers, growth leads, and SaaS founders who want faster output without sacrificing control; developers and indie hackers are also well positioned because many of these problems can be solved with workflow tools, browser extensions, plugins, APIs, or add-ons that fit into existing marketing stacks.

Promising solution spaces include brand-governance layers that score drafts against style rules, campaign generators that lock in approved assets and layouts, disclosure copilots that pull from legal libraries, automated fact-checking systems that verify claims against sources, and strategy-audit tools that flag risk before a campaign is approved.
